BlockBeats News, December 9th, according to official sources, Web3 social network Tako Protocol announced that it will join the tweet tokenization project Trends to continue its development in the Solana ecosystem.

As Farcaster shifts towards a more decentralized social direction, Tako Protocol has officially concluded its exploration in the Farcaster ecosystem. Following this announcement, Tako Protocol will cease to provide all data services related to Farcaster.

Tako was once one of Farcaster's largest clients (also the largest client for Chinese users, with 12,000 registered users). Tako Protocol looks forward to collaborating with Trends to continue exploring the future of information, media, and social interactions.
